About
Born into one of New Zealand’s most well-known cricketing families, Michael Bracewell was almost destined to take up the sport. A left-handed batter and occasional wicketkeeper, Bracewell has forged his own path in New Zealand domestic cricket with his aggressive strokeplay and game-changing abilities.
Bracewell hails from Masterton and represents Wellington in domestic competitions. While he initially made his mark as a wicketkeeper, he often plays as a specialist batter due to the presence of other glovemen like Tom Blundell and Devon Conway in the side. Known for his attacking style, Bracewell has often drawn comparisons to Adam Gilchrist, a player he openly models his game on.
Cricket runs deep in the Bracewell bloodline. His father Mark was a well-known domestic player, while uncles Brendon and John Bracewell, along with cousin Doug, have all represented New Zealand at the international level. Michael, alongside cousin Doug, also featured in New Zealand’s U19 World Cup squad in 2010.
Apart from cricket, Michael is a natural athlete with experience in rugby and basketball, a testament to his all-round sporting background.
